The nonprofit organization, The Partnership for Public Service, and the American University’s Institute for the Study of Public Policy Implementation launched a website, www.bestplacestowork.org. On the site, they share the results of their study of the U.S. Office of Personnel Management’s 2002 Federal Human Capital Survey.

The study ranks GSA as the fourth best executive agency to work for in its “Best in Class” rating. In addition to this overall rating, the study rates each agency in 10 performance categories. Categories range from matching employee skills to mission requirements to family-friendly culture and benefits. GSA exceeded the government average in every category!
